Azyumardi Azra is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Education and Political Science and International Relations. According to data from OpenAlex, Azyumardi Azra has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 202 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 16 papers in Education and 7 papers in Political Science and International Relations. Recurrent topics in Azyumardi Azra’s work include Islamic Studies and Radicalism (18 papers), Islamic Finance and Communication (14 papers) and Asian Studies and History (14 papers). Azyumardi Azra is often cited by papers focused on Islamic Studies and Radicalism (18 papers), Islamic Finance and Communication (14 papers) and Asian Studies and History (14 papers). Azyumardi Azra collaborates with scholars based in Indonesia, United States and Bangladesh. Azyumardi Azra's co-authors include Arskal Salim, Omar Khalidi, Peter Riddell, Alexander Knysh, Stephen F. Dale, M. de Jonge, William Gervase Clarence‐Smith, Engseng Ho, Sumit K. Mandal and Syed Farid Alatas and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Islamic Studies, Journal of Asian Public Policy and STUDIA ISLAMIKA.
